Matakis Busts Blanchard

Level 19 : Blinds 6,000/12,000, 12,000 ante

Duane Blanchard moved all in for 90,000 from the button and Ian Matakis called from the big blind.

Blanchard J10
Matakis QJ

The 7Q3 flop put Matakis in control, but gave Blanchard some back door out to a straight or a flush.

A 8 on the turn removed the flush outs, but still left to Matakis to sweat a straight. He breathed a sigh of relief when the 2 hit the river, and Blanchard headed to the cage.
